Pull request description:

  Currently the ci yaml has a mix of Bash and Pwsh snippets, which is problematic:

  * The `shellcheck` tool does not review the Bash
  * The ci yaml is not merged with master on re-runs, but the code is, leading to possibly confusing CI errors on re-runs
  * The Pwsh isn't reviewed at all by any tool
  * It is tedious to run the CI commands locally on Windows

  Fix all issues by extracting them into a step-based Python script.

fabdd4e823 ci: Refactor Windows CI into script
This makes it easier to:

* Run the exact command of any CI type and step locally
* Re-Run older CI tasks on GHA and using the latest merged config.
  (.github/ci-windows.py is merged with master on re-runs, but
  .github/workflows/ci.yml is NOT)

Also, writing it in Python has benefits:

* Any developer (even non-Windows ones) can read and modify the script.
* Python is already required for tests, so no new dependency is needed.
